Output 83c361bb08be30da591cb366fd047dc2f4ec2ed7a87dd79ce7bd71fa19dafd91:1

value
490053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66cbcd7a84a7c50834a60b37cb0fab57d98d7d6 OP_EQUAL
address
3KnBykYmacs8nYiSSUxjUUTfPh9B9Rn77n
transaction
83c361bb08be30da591cb366fd047dc2f4ec2ed7a87dd79ce7bd71fa19dafd91
confirmations
280583
spent
true